How Pudgy Penguins Landed the Las Vegas Sphere—After Dogwifhat Couldn’t

The Las Vegas Sphere is currently displaying animations of Pudgy Penguins, bringing the crypto-native brand’s cartoon characters to one of the most prominent digital billboards in the U.S. The campaign runs for about seven days and was planned over several months, according to details shared around the activation.

The display stands out not just for its scale, but for what it represents: a Web3-born intellectual property appearing in a mainstream advertising venue while avoiding any direct reference to crypto.

Pudgy Penguins is best known for its blue-chip NFT collection, and the brand also has a related meme coin. But the Sphere creative focuses on the characters and the company’s physical consumer products, with no visible mention of NFTs or tokens.

That approach appears to have been critical. Earlier this year, the community behind Solana meme coin Dogwifhat (WIF) attempted to secure a Sphere advertisement after raising roughly $700,000 through crowdfunding. Organizers had publicly claimed a planned appearance, but the venue later clarified that the campaign was not approved. The effort ultimately failed due to venue restrictions, and the funds were later refunded, according to Decrypt.

The contrast between the two efforts has fueled discussion across crypto communities, with some traders reacting strongly to Pudgy Penguins’ success where Dogwifhat did not. The key difference, based on the available information, is that Pudgy Penguins’ Sphere wrap was positioned as a mainstream merchandise-led campaign rather than a crypto promotion.

Pudgy Penguins’ move also reflects a broader shift in how NFT-linked brands are trying to reach non-crypto audiences. The project was acquired in April 2022 by entrepreneur Luca Netz for approximately $2.5 million in Ether, with a goal of expanding beyond digital collectibles. As NFT markets faced a downturn in 2025, Pudgy Penguins increasingly emphasized physical toy production and other consumer product initiatives.

In that context, the Sphere activation functions as a high-visibility brand placement for the penguin characters—one that fits within advertising constraints that have challenged overtly crypto-themed campaigns.
